How Much Does It Cost to Make a Party Invitation?53
The cost of making party invitations can vary greatly depending on several factors, including the number of invitations needed, the design complexity, the printing method, and any additional embellishments or materials. Here's a general breakdown of the costs associated with each step of the invitation-making process:
1. Design Costs
The design cost can range from free to hundreds of dollars. If you're creating the invitation yourself using a free online tool or template, there's no design cost. However, if you're hiring a professional designer, the cost can vary depending on their experience, the complexity of the design, and the turnaround time. Design fees typically start at around $50 for a basic invitation and can go up to several hundred dollars for elaborate custom designs.
2. Printing Costs
The printing cost depends on the printing method, the quantity of invitations, and the paper quality. Digital printing is generally the most cost-effective option for small quantities, with prices starting at around $0.20 per invitation. Offset printing is more expensive, but it produces higher-quality results and is a better choice for large quantities. Offset printing costs typically start at around $1 per invitation.
3. Paper Quality
The type of paper used can also affect the cost. Standard paper is the most affordable option, but it's not as durable as thicker papers. Premium papers, such as linen or cardstock, are more expensive but provide a more sophisticated look and feel. Prices for premium paper typically start at around $0.50 per sheet.
4. Embellishments and Materials
Additional embellishments and materials can add to the cost of invitations. These may include envelopes, ribbons, stickers, or other decorative elements. The cost of these items can vary depending on the type and quantity needed. For example, envelopes typically cost around $0.20 each, while ribbons can range from $0.20 to $1 per yard.
5. Labor Costs
If you're assembling the invitations yourself, there's no additional labor cost. However, if you're hiring someone to assemble and mail the invitations, the cost can vary depending on the hourly rate of the person and the number of invitations. Assembly and mailing costs typically start at around $0.50 per invitation.
Total Cost
By considering all of these factors, you can estimate the total cost of making party invitations. Here's an example of how the costs might break down for a simple invitation with a print run of 100 copies:
Design: Free (using an online template)
Printing: $20 (digital printing at $0.20 per invitation)
Paper: $5 (premium paper at $0.50 per sheet)
Envelopes: $20 (envelopes at $0.20 each)
Assembly and Mailing: $0 (self-assembled and mailed)
Total: $45
Keep in mind that this is just an example, and the actual cost of your invitations may vary depending on the specific choices you make.
